<p>"Highlander" star Christopher Lambert suffered a <a href="https://foxnews.com/category/entertainment/events/illness"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">medical scare</a> after collapsing at Steel City Con in Philadelphia during a meet and greet over the weekend.</p><p>The 69-year-old had to leave the convention due to a "personal issue," according to the event's <a href="https://www.facebook.com/SteelCityComicCon/posts/pfbid02X5nrb3tLXyaSJFdgmHzw6RnCRJjUtqHMvxFFCzDgkaHHzKtmVWDCpBpvCarYvV47l?rdid=HjVov7f1xtgPZmMB&amp;share_url=https%3A%2F%2Fwww.facebook.com%2Fshare%2Fp%2F1FBWQZHV6r%2F" target="_blank" rel="nofollow noopener">Facebook</a> page.</p><p>The French actor was subsequently taken to a local hospital by ambulance, according to <a href="https://www.tmz.com/2026/08/08/highlander-star-christopher-lambert-collapses-at-comic-con/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er nofollow">TMZ</a>.</p><p>A representative for Lambert told TMZ that the actor was "perfectly OK" and resting at his hotel. The representative said Lambert had not gotten enough sleep the previous night and had eaten little during the day, causing his blood sugar to drop.</p><p>Steel City Con representatives told People that the actor had become overheated and dehydrated.</p><p><a href="https://www.foxnews.com/newsletters?cmpid=fnfirstnl" target="_blank" rel="noopener"><strong>CLICK HERE TO SIGN UP FOR THE ENTERTAINMENT NEWSLETTER</strong></a></p><p>"Christopher was feeling a little overheated and dehydrated. He had to sit down, but he is doing great today," organizers told the outlet.</p><p>A representative for Lambert did not immediately respond to Fox News Digital's request for comment.</p><p>The convention said Lambert was expected to return Sunday for scheduled photo opportunities and a noon Q&amp;A panel. Steel City Con’s official schedule lists Lambert as appearing Friday, Saturday and Sunday during the Aug. 7-9 event.</p><p>Lambert is best known for starring as immortal swordsman Connor MacLeod in the 1986 <a href="https://www.foxnews.com/category/entertainment/movies"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">cult classic "Highlander."</a> He also portrayed Tarzan in 1984’s "Greystoke: The Legend of Tarzan, Lord of the Apes" and Lord Raiden in the 1995 <a href="https://foxnews.com/category/entertainment"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">film adaptation</a> of "Mortal Kombat."</p><p><a href="https://www.foxnews.com/entertainment" target="_blank" rel="noopener"><strong>LIKE WHAT YOU'RE READING?
